THOUSAND OAKS, Calif. — Cal Lutheran men's basketball opened the 2022-23 season at home, showing spurts of fantastic play as they took on Illinois Tech on Thursday night. The Kingsmen fell to the Scarlet Hawks 98-89.
Illinois Tech got revenge on Cal Lutheran for last year. The Kingsman started last year by defeated the Scarlet Hawks at their place.
The Scarlet Hawks were efficient in Gilbert Arena, shooting 59.6 percent from the field, with the Kingsmen going 44.6. The teams were almost even from three-point range as Cal Lutheran was 44.4 percent and Illinois Tech was 43.8.
Five Kingsmen scored in double figures and Devon Lewis led the team with 20. Brock Susko was next with 15, Desi Burrage recorded 13 and Tommy Griffitts and Riley O'Connor had 12 each.
Burrage was at the top of the leaderboard for rebounds with eight, Susko was next with seven and Griffitts added five. Lewis, Burrage and O'Connor all dished out three assists and Susko had two steals.
The Kingsmen got off to a fast start as Lewis and Logan McCullough made back-to-back three pointers to start the game. No matter what type of run a team went on, the other team responded, as the game has nine tied and five lead changes. Cal Lutheran took its biggest lead of the game at 20-13 with 10:58 left in the half.
The Scarlet Hawks chipped away at the lead and eventually tied the game up at 25 with 7:09 to go in the first. Then it was Illinois Tech's turn to take the lead and they were up 41-38 at the half.
In the second half, every time the Scarlet Hawks took a sizeable lead, the Kingsmen would fight back. Down 67-58, Cal Lutheran overcame a rough stretch and were down 77-74 with 5:20 remaining. The Scarlet Hawks took final control after that, went on a 14-4 run, and took a 91-78 lead with just over a minute to play. That final lead was what Illinois Tech needed as they took the game.
The Kingsmen play their first road game on Saturday. Cal Lutheran is at The Master's University with tip-off set for 6 p.m.
